Coming from a Vortex Viper PST II 1-6x, it’s impressive how much more magnification Bushnell provides for nearly the same price ($599vs$699 when on sale). The optics red illumination is impressive, it is very bright when needed. Zeroing is easier and more logical on this scope than others.The only two complaints I have is getting the battery door open was a chore. There really isn’t any decent included instruction manual either. The company seems to assume everyone will just figure it out, but I can assure you many newbies would likely get frustrated by the process. The battery door was on so tight I had to use a pair of pliers to force it open, with a microfiber wrapped around to prevent any paint chipping.The second and final complaint is the scope includes a plastic tool meant to help loosen the turrets etc, but my plastic tool simply broke when I tried to do so. I ended up having to use a coin which sadly marks the paint a bit. If you go to reviews on YT you’ll see many have the marks on the turrets. I’d like to see the groove be deeper to allow a plastic pick/pry tool to avoid paint damage.
